For those of you who don't know, FEX is Frank Xavier who is more widely known for his work as 1/3rd of Infusion. On the latest FEX single, Frank takes Freeland's Marine Parade label to the electro side of things with the stand out B side, "Last Train". A deep, tinkering track with a sticky, melodic hook and vocoder madness. The A side isn't bad either, more of the classic Infusion style we've witnessed on such releases as "Dead Souls". Dark, mean and nasty...
I listened to this in the record shop on 45rpm by mistake because it was in the DnB section. I think 'Last Train' sounds quite good at that speed and so i bought it for my DnB sets! Pitching it up that much makes the snares really tight and makes it sound like a Rascal & Klone tune. At 45rpm the tempo is about 175BPM so it's perfectly mixable with other DnB records.
